What is the paper thickness of 44mm Thermal Paper Roll?

First off, let’s talk about why paper thickness matters. The thickness of thermal paper can have a significant impact on its performance. A thicker paper is generally more durable and less likely to tear or jam in your printer. It can also provide better image quality, as it can hold the thermal image more effectively. On the other hand, a thinner paper may be more cost – effective and can be used in applications where durability isn’t the top priority.

When it comes to 44mm thermal paper rolls, the most common paper thicknesses range from about 50 microns to 80 microns. A 50 – micron paper is relatively thin. It’s a good option if you’re looking for a more budget – friendly solution or if your printer can handle thinner paper well. This type of paper is often used in applications like cash registers in small businesses or point – of – sale systems where the print volume isn’t extremely high.

For example, if you run a small coffee shop and use the thermal paper for printing receipts, a 50 – micron paper might be just fine. It’ll get the job done, and you won’t break the bank on paper costs.

On the other hand, a 80 – micron paper is thicker and more robust. It’s great for applications where the paper needs to withstand a bit of wear and tear. For instance, if you’re using the thermal paper in a self – service kiosk where customers might handle the receipts roughly, or in a high – volume printing environment like a large supermarket checkout counter, an 80 – micron paper would be a better choice.

The thicker paper is also less likely to curl or wrinkle, which can be a big plus. You don’t want your customers to receive a receipt that’s all crumpled up, right?

Now, how do you decide which thickness is right for you? Well, it depends on a few factors. First, think about your printer. Some printers are designed to work best with a specific range of paper thicknesses. You’ll want to check your printer’s manual to see what it recommends.

Next, consider your usage. If you’re printing a large number of receipts every day, a thicker paper might save you money in the long run by reducing the number of paper jams and replacements. But if you’re only printing a few receipts here and there, a thinner paper could be a more economical option.

Another thing to keep in mind is the environment where the paper will be used. If it’s a humid or high – temperature environment, a thicker paper might be more resistant to damage.
